Book Description:

In "Moon and Sixpence," Somerset Maugham takes a fascinating look into the life of Charles Strickland, a man who gives up his comfortable life as a stock broker, breaks the social contract, abandons his family, and takes up painting. These changes condemn him to a life of poverty and disdain by most who know him. Author Biography
Maugham, W. Somerset (Author)
Writer William Somerset Maugham was born in Paris on January 25, 1874. He attended St. Thomas's Medical School in London.

A prolific writer, Maugham produced novels, short stories, plays, and an autobiographical novel, "Of Human Bondage." Although he remains popular for his novels and short stories, when he was alive his plays, now dated, were also popular, and in 1908 four of his plays ran simultaneously.

Maugham died in Nice, France, on December 16, 1965.
